Life doesn’t always come with the right words.

Life, Well Worded is a place for thoughtful perspectives on family, friendship, relationships, and those moments when you know what you want to say – you’re just not quite sure how to say it.

I was fortunate to grow up in a large, close family where conversation was simply a part of life. Experiences were shared, stories were told, opinions were welcomed, and there was rarely a shortage of something to talk about.

Along the way, we learned how to be comfortable with all kinds of people in all kinds of places. Knowing how to “read the room” mattered – but so did knowing what to say once you did.

My parents taught us that the right words could help you feel equally at home in the Waffle House or the White House.

That lesson stayed with me.

Over the years, I’ve come to appreciate just how much the words we choose matter. They can soften a difficult conversation, make someone feel understood, help us stand our ground without being unkind, or simply say what’s in our hearts a little better.

My hope is to help you find that sweet spot between what you want to say and how you want it to be heard – with a little perspective on life, relationships, and everything in between.
